ADA Member Exclusive Webinar—Join other American Diabetes Association® (ADA) professional members for a live, one-hour panel discussion webinar, Fear of Hypoglycemia – Is It So Bad? In this ADA webinar, an expert panel will explore the complex issue of fear of hypoglycemia (FOH) across different types of diabetes and life stages. Attendees will gain a deeper understanding of FOH as both a pathological concern and a potential protective factor, and how it impacts diabetes management. The session will also highlight strategies for supporting patients and families through behavioral interventions, diabetes education, and tailored treatment approaches. The panel will share five actionable tips for supporting professionals and people with diabetes, as well as host a live Q&A session at the end of the webinar.  

The session is part of the Hands On: Tips to Improve Diabetes Care webinar series, which is available exclusively to ADA professional members and presented by the ADA’s Behavioral Medicine & Psychology, Diabetes in Primary Care, Exercise Physiology, and Diabetes Technology Interest Groups. The series is supported by funding from The Leona M. and Harry B. Helmsley Charitable Trust.
